When purchasing high-defense servers from the US, first clarify business peak and protection levels, sort out price comparison dimensions (bandwidth, cleaning capability, SLA, traffic billing, etc.), prepare negotiation chips (competitor pricing, long-term/trial period, bundled services), and focus on identifying hidden fees and contract terms. Through performance verification and third-party evaluation, suppliers are ultimately confirmed, maximizing cost-effectiveness and controlling risk.
Where should you start evaluating suppliers and configurations?
The first step starts from business needs, clarifying bandwidth peaks, concurrent connections, tolerable latency, and cleanup trigger thresholds; At the same time, based on the access region, priority is given to US data centers or CDN nodes. When evaluating vendors, check their network backbone, BGP routes, number of ASNs, and their distribution in the US data center, and verify whether they offer on-demand scaling and real-time traffic mirroring. Align the configuration of the US high-defense server with the actual traffic curve to avoid overconfiguration or under-configuration.
How do you compare the cost-performance ratio of different quotes?
Price comparison should not focus solely on bandwidth unit price, but also on cleaning bandwidth (cleaning peak), cleaning strategy (burst vs. constant), SLA availability, recovery time, and technical support response. For comparison, the total cost is split into fixed costs (hosts, bandwidth packages) and variable costs (over-traffic, post-cleaning billing, additional IPs), and converted into monthly or single-concurrency costs. Using a unified table to list key indicators and score them by weight, it objectively reflects cost-effectiveness.
Which negotiation strategy best reduces total procurement costs?
Various strategies can be employed during negotiations: offering competing product quotes to negotiate prices or additional services; Exchanging long-term contracts for discounts or price stability; Seek probation or POC to verify capabilities before signing the contract; Request free data buffers, free IPs, or first-month discounts; Package network, hardware, and operations for better pricing. Remember to use data and alternatives as bargaining chips, and avoid relying solely on verbal promises.
Why pay special attention to hidden fees and terms of service?
Hidden fees often significantly increase costs over long-term use, commonly including over-traffic billing, post-cleaning traffic billing, DDoS trigger fees, traffic mirroring fees, and cross-region traffic fees. The terms of service should pay attention to the SLA compensation details, maintenance window, liability boundaries, and data ownership. Ensure that key indicators (such as cleaning bandwidth, response time, and compensation ratio) are clearly stated in the contract and that monitoring and arbitration mechanisms are stipulated.
How can you verify the supplier's protection capabilities and performance?
Suppliers are required to provide historical attack incident handling cases, third-party test reports, or actual test data; Conduct small-scale stress tests/drills where feasible to observe cleaning delays and false alarm rates; Verify whether it supports traffic mirroring, black hole filtering, and whitelist policies; See if it can work with your monitoring system and provide real-time alerts. Actual testing is more reliable than verbal promises.
What budget and contract duration are more suitable?
Budget depends on business importance and risk tolerance: key business recommendations are set aside for higher budgets for stronger protection and shorter response times; For short-term trials or project-based services, pay-as-you-go billing is preferred, while long-term stable services are better suited for annual payments in exchange for discounts. Contract duration and flexibility must be balanced; it is recommended to include reasonable clauses in the contract for on-demand expansion and early termination.
Where can you find reliable resources for price comparison and negotiation?
Supplier information can be obtained through industry forums, technical communities, peer recommendations, cloud markets, and third-party evaluation agencies; Use price comparison tools or purchase list templates for standardized comparison; Hire experienced agents or consulting firms to provide professional support during negotiations. Be sure to verify information sources and prioritize suppliers with real cases and verifiable data.
How to manage post-procurement operations and risk control?
After signing, establish a regular monitoring and drill mechanism, formulate DDoS response procedures, and agree on coordinated plans with suppliers; Regularly review attack logs, adjust defense strategies, and assess cost changes. Maintaining multiple vendors or CDNs as backups can reduce single-point risk, while evaluating automated scaling and billing alerts to avoid overspending.
